1. Tradition Tattoo

Brisbane’s self-described ‘best tattooists’ (oussss big call) Tradition Tattoo is a seven-person studio with a focus on the classic sailor tattoos of yore. Understanding that tradition needs to started somewhere they also have a dab hand in Japanese, American and blackwork tattoos. The team also offering laser removal by way of MJD, showing that even they understand that sometimes tradition needs to be scrubbed. If you are after quality work, you really can’t go past guys like Ben Rouke, JonFTW and Hamish Clarke, who are not only some of the best tattoo artist in Brisbane, but some of the best traditional tattooers in Australia.

2. Shinko Tattoo

Started in 2014, Justin Smeeth and J.J Allinson have wasted no time in building Shinko Tattoo into a phenomenally-talented nine artist strong team to help realise your tattoo fantasy in the flesh. They cover every style imaginable but claim speciality Japanese, blackwork, realism, neo-traditional, and Americana. We see no reason not to go all-in.

3. Westside Tattoo

For over 20 years, Westside Tattoo has offered up some amazing artwork from Brisbane’s best tattoo artists. With esteemed artists Matt Cunnington and David Ransome (pictured) leading the charge, Westside has the full experience on lock. Focusing on American traditional and Japanese as stalwarts, the West End tattoo studio is a beacon for those looking to elevate their work.

4. Wild at Heart

Wild at Heart has spent almost 30 years living up to the name. Founded in 1992 they have been in Brisbane’s CBD longer than anyone. With so much skin in the game, it’s hard to deny they have had a big hand in shaping the cities tattoo tastes. Focus on traditional tattoos here. Don’t be afraid to step into floral territory though.

11. Pacifink

Pacifink started off with Michelle and Pappy Walters branching out into Wynnum to build their own studio in 2008. Now there are four artists on board and hundreds of gorgeous pieces behind them. The team bring experience with authentic Polynesian tribal tattoos as well as insane photorealistic detail.

Things to Consider for Brisbane Tattoo Artists

It doesn’t need to be said too much, but getting the right fit for you is of the utmost performance. Do your own research, stalk an Instagram or two, and make sure your tats are the exact fit for you. If it’s not a hell yes, it’s a no. With your due diligence done, never forget that a good tattoo isn’t cheap and a cheap tattoo isn’t good. With that in mind, here’s our list of the best tattoo shops in Brisbane.

  • Price: Quality artists demand quality prices and this is particularly true in the world of tattooing. While you might find a cheaper alternative, it’s always a good idea to invest heavily in the artist. Remember, it’s on you for life.
  • Bookings: Brisbane is a city that loves a good tattoo, so it’s little surprise that the top Brisbane tattoo artists are usually booked out months in advance. While many shops do take walk-ins, you’re always better off booking ahead of time.
  • Pain: No make mistake about it, tattoos hurt. make sure you are aware of your pain tolerance before you step foot into the shop. No one likes a quitter!
